2nd Annual Indian Market and Powwow
September 4, 2010
Add Review/Comment
Join us at Memorial Park in Woodland Park, CO on September 4th for a family event featuring 20 nationally recognized Native Artists, Powwow dancers/drum groups/singers, and Native American food vendors. Twenty nationally-known Native American artists and craftsmen have been invited to showcase their jewelry, artwork, traditional-style flutes, pottery, woven horsehair baskets, silverwork, and more. Native drums and dancers, live birds of prey, live wolf interactive display, and Native American food.
